Co-Teachers
Invite other teachers to help manage your class:
Adding a Co-Teacher
- Go to Class Settings → Co-Teachers
- Click "Invite Co-Teacher"
- Enter their email address
- Select their permission level:
- Full Access: Can do everything you can
- Standard: Can give Experience, strikes, approve requests
- View Only: Can see class but not make changes
- Send invitation
The co-teacher will receive an email and can accept the invitation.
Permission Levels Explained
Full Access:
- Manage all students
- Configure class settings
- Add/remove co-teachers
- Delete class
- Access all features
Standard:
- Give Experience, mana, gold, strikes
- Approve/deny requests
- View activity log
- Cannot change settings
- Cannot manage other teachers
View Only:
- See class dashboard
- View student profiles
- View activity log
- Cannot make any changes
- Good for student teachers or observers
Managing Co-Teachers
- View all co-teachers and their permission levels
- Edit permissions at any time
- Remove co-teachers
- See co-teacher activity in logs
Use Cases
Team Teaching:
- Both teachers have full access
- Share management responsibilities
- Consistent across periods
Special Education:
- Para-educator has standard access
- Can reward and manage behavior
- Cannot change core settings
Student Teacher:
- View only access initially
- Upgrade to standard as they learn
- Remove when placement ends
Administration:
- View only access for principal
- Can observe without interfering
- Accountability and transparency

Removing Students
When a student leaves your class:
- Click on the student
- Select "Remove from Class"
- Choose what to do:
- Archive: Keep data, remove from active roster
- Delete: Permanently remove all data
Archive is recommended - you can restore them later if needed.

Deleting/Archiving Classes
At the end of the school year:
Archiving (Recommended)
- Go to Class Settings → General
- Click "Archive Class"
- Confirm
What happens:
- Class is removed from active list
- All data is preserved
- Read-only access maintained
- Can restore later if needed
- Can export data anytime
Benefits:
- Keep records for future reference
- Compare year-to-year
- Show students their progress later
- No loss of data
Deleting
- Go to Class Settings → General
- Click "Delete Class"
- Type class name to confirm
- Confirm deletion
Warning: This is permanent and cannot be undone!
What happens:
- All class data deleted
- All student data removed
- Cannot be recovered
- Login codes invalidated
When to delete:
- You're certain you'll never need the data
- Privacy requirements mandate deletion
- Starting completely fresh
Exporting Data Before Deletion
If you plan to delete:
- Go to Class Settings → Export
- Select what to export:
- Student roster
- All activity log
- Final stats
- Complete history
- Choose format (CSV, PDF, JSON)
- Download
Keep this file for your records.
